## Auth for Bulk Edits

Bulk edits in the Ledgerloom admin table go through the `/bulk` endpoint, gated by the internal Gatewick auth service. Row-level checks still apply; batches over 500 are rejected. Use the shared service identity, not personal sessions, so audit logs stay clean. For this sprint's demo environment, the Gatewick key is provided below.

API key for fahip-kahip: zpat23_XiJGUHz5xfaAtaIqUkus0rh

Facilities Ticket — Cleaning Crew Access, Brindle Annex

For new starters handling evening lock-up: the Sorano Cleaning crew arrives nightly at 21:30 via the annex side door. Check their rota sheet, note arrival in the log, and ensure the storeroom is relocked afterward. To let them through the side door, enter the access code below.

badge for yaweg-hafog: bdg-GX-6

## Artifact signing: N+1 fix release

The GraphQL N+1 query fix for the Orchardline catalog resolver ships in build series 4.19. The patch batches nested `variant` lookups through a dataloader, cutting query counts on the product page by roughly 40x. Because this touches the query planner, the release goes through the hardened signing path: artifacts are built in the sealed pipeline, hashed, and signed before publication. New team members should verify any 4.19 artifact they pull locally against this key.

deploy key for kajof-fajop: bky6_gDHw9Q